Imaginary roots appear in a quadratic equation when the discriminant of the quadratic equation — the part under the square root sign ( b2 – 4 ac) — is negative. We use if + past simple, would + infinitive. For example: If I had money, I would buy a new computer. (In reality, I cannot buy a new computer because I don’t have money.)
